We stayed as a family in MO Taipei. The hotel, rooms, restaurants were good but the soft product (service) was terrible.
Everyone working there were like work experience kids - very formal and projecting the image of wanting to help without actually helping.
Examples- we went with my 2 year old - we asked for coloring books that we knew they had and this is what we got. No crayons, pencils ect.. had to call again and got 3 pens (blue, red, black) 🤔

Asked for warm milk in a takeaway cup with straw every morning at breakfast (to give to the 2 year old), and got scalding hot each day - in a normal cup - mind you it was the same 2 people we asked each day. They all smile and say yes every time, even after I remind them that last time it was too hot.

When we were leaving the hotel to go to the airport, we specifically asked for a car with a car seat. Everyone said yes - concierge and the duty manager. What we got was a XL car with no car seat. Had to wait for 20 min and get stressed for them to sort it out.

We asked for lunch options at 2pm for the family as the little one wakes up from her nap after 2 and the reply was that all their restaurants close from 2.3 to 5.3pm. No other options or suggestions.

So many examples of service failures and we were not being difficult or asking for unreasonable things.

For us it was amateur hour run by kids with no proper training or supervision.
